Transaction 7e79639a31446bac814c8c55c268acf01b1e60232cc29f3a14dffc2dcd5e7619
1 Input
1 Output
-
7e79639a31446bac814c8c55c268acf01b1e60232cc29f3a14dffc2dcd5e7619:0
- value
- 996423
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d2b411bf741411586717ee3b1093cf19ec6201d OP_EQUAL
- address
- 34MFLUFHCMURe4HjBtsdbTBw4YDPnfBr8V